Key Insights

The colorless polyimide varnish market, currently valued at approximately $40 million in 2025, is projected to experience steady growth, with a compound annual growth rate (CAGR) of 2.9% from 2025 to 2033. This growth is fueled by increasing demand from various sectors, particularly electronics and aerospace, where high-performance insulation and protective coatings are crucial. The rising adoption of advanced electronics, including 5G infrastructure and high-speed computing systems, is a key driver, as colorless polyimide varnishes offer superior dielectric properties and thermal stability compared to traditional alternatives. Furthermore, the growing emphasis on miniaturization and improved efficiency in electronic devices necessitates the use of thin, high-performance coatings like colorless polyimide varnishes. The market is also benefiting from ongoing research and development efforts focused on enhancing the material's properties, including improved flexibility, adhesion, and chemical resistance. Key players such as UBE, Mitsubishi Gas Chemical Company, TOK, Mitsui Chemicals, and Kolon Industries are driving innovation and expanding their product portfolios to meet the evolving demands of the market. Competitive landscape is expected to remain relatively consolidated with ongoing mergers and acquisitions potentially shaping the market in the future.

The restraints to market growth are primarily related to the relatively high cost of colorless polyimide varnishes compared to other coating options. However, the superior performance characteristics and long-term benefits often outweigh this cost for applications requiring high reliability and durability. The market segmentation is likely diverse, categorized by application (e.g., printed circuit boards, flexible circuits, aerospace components), type of varnish (e.g., solution, powder), and end-use industry. Regional variations in market growth will likely reflect the distribution of key industries and technological advancements across different geographic areas. Continued advancements in material science and manufacturing processes will be crucial in driving down costs and further expanding the applications of colorless polyimide varnishes in the coming years. Therefore, despite potential economic fluctuations, the forecast for the colorless polyimide varnish market remains positive, underpinned by strong underlying technological and industrial trends.

Driving Forces: What's Propelling the Colourless Polyimide Varnish Market?

Several factors are driving the expansion of the colourless polyimide varnish market. The electronics industry's relentless pursuit of miniaturization and improved performance in devices necessitates high-performance, thermally stable insulating materials. Colourless polyimide varnishes perfectly meet this demand, offering superior dielectric properties and high-temperature resistance compared to traditional alternatives. The automotive sector, increasingly focused on electric vehicles (EVs) and hybrid vehicles, requires robust and durable coatings for various components, creating another significant market driver. Furthermore, the aerospace industry's stringent requirements for lightweight, high-performance materials are also contributing to the market's growth, as colourless polyimide varnishes provide excellent protection against harsh environmental conditions. The expanding renewable energy sector, particularly in solar panel production and wind turbine manufacturing, adds to the demand for these versatile coatings. Lastly, advancements in varnish formulation, leading to improved properties like flexibility, adhesion, and chemical resistance, broaden the range of applications and further fuel market growth. These factors collectively ensure that the demand for colourless polyimide varnishes will continue to grow substantially in the coming years.

Challenges and Restraints in Colourless Polyimide Varnish Market

Despite the promising growth prospects, the colourless polyimide varnish market faces certain challenges. High production costs associated with specialized raw materials and complex manufacturing processes can limit market penetration, particularly in price-sensitive sectors. The stringent regulatory landscape surrounding volatile organic compounds (VOCs) and environmental concerns necessitates the development and adoption of more environmentally friendly formulations, adding to production costs and complexities. Competition from alternative coating materials, such as epoxy resins and acrylics, poses a challenge, especially in applications where the superior performance characteristics of polyimide varnishes might not be absolutely critical. Moreover, the relatively complex application processes and the need for specialized equipment can limit the accessibility of this technology to smaller enterprises. Addressing these challenges requires continuous innovation in manufacturing processes, the development of sustainable and cost-effective formulations, and targeted marketing strategies that highlight the unique advantages of colourless polyimide varnishes in specific applications.
